South American Academy of motion picture arts withdrew the nomination for the award "Oscar" in a category "the Best song for the movie", which was nominated song "Alone Yet Not Alone", written for the eponymous movie "One is not alone." Unprecedented decision was taken in consequence of the acts of the composer Bruce Broughton, who violates the order of voting.
By all the rules, 240 academics from relevant music Committee, owning the voting, received disks with songs and soundtracks without marking and instructions some data about composers and other related information. The academicians were offered after listening to choose the 5 best songs and send completed ballots to the Academy.
According to ITAR-TASS, Broughton, which is the former Governor of the Academy and member profile musical Committee during the voting process sent email messages to employees. He recalled that, from among the remaining candidates are and his song.
"Using the provisions of the former Governor and current member of the Executive Committee in view of its own nomination creates the appearance of unfair superiority", said the President of the Academy Cheryl Boone Isaacs. The Committee agreed that the actions of Broughton were contrary to the established voting procedure.
Consequently, the nomination is now represented only 4 songs: "Happy", written for the animated movie "Despicable me 2" (Despicable Me 2, music Farrell Williams), "Let It Go" from the cartoon "the Cold heart" (Frozen, music and lyrics of Christen Anderson-Lopez and Robert Lopez). Also, for the victory, arguing "The Moon Song" from the picture "She" (Her music Karen OS words spike Jonze) and "Ordinary Love" from the film "Long walk to freedom" ("Mandela: Long Walk to Freedom", U2).
